In Italy, smart technologies are increasingly being included in IV equipment. Connectivity options are now available on advanced infusion pumps and catheters, enabling easy interaction with electronic health records (EHRs) and hospital information systems. These smart gadgets allow for real-time data monitoring, dose tracking, and remote changes, which improve precision and allow healthcare providers to administer personalised treatments more efficiently. In Italy, catheter technology is progressing with an emphasis on improving functionality and lowering problems. Smart catheters are being developed with sensors to monitor insertion depth, flow rates, and tip location. These advancements aim to increase catheter placement accuracy and reduce hazards during intravenous access procedures. Drip chambers product is growing at significant pace in Italy IV equipments market. Drip chambers are critical in preventing air bubbles from entering the patient's bloodstream during intravenous medication. The emphasis on patient safety drives the demand for sophisticated drip chambers designed to properly manage air and assure the delivery of air-free fluids, reducing the risk of air embolisms. Manufacturers are creating drip chambers with features that prioritise patient comfort during IV therapy. Drip chambers that are designed to eliminate noise, minimise fluid turbulence, and optimise drip rates contribute to a better patient experience, which drives their popularity among healthcare practitioners. Continuous developments in drip chamber technology contribute to their greater utilisation. Innovative designs include improved air venting systems, expanded filtering capabilities, and improved fluid flow dynamics, which optimise drip chamber performance and provide smoother administration of intravenous fluids. Drip chambers adhere to stringent quality standards and regulatory guidelines in Italy, ensuring their safety and efficacy. Compliance with these standards bolsters confidence in the reliability and performance of drip chambers among healthcare professionals, driving their increased usage. In Italy, there is a shift towards patient-centred care paradigms. Patients prefer to get treatments in the privacy of their own homes, resulting in an increase in demand for IV equipment suitable for home care settings. This segment's growth is being driven by the introduction of improved IV equipment designed for safe and efficient use in residential settings. Patients can self-administer intravenous therapies under remote monitoring thanks to portable infusion pumps, user-friendly catheters, and specialised accessories. The increased prevalence of chronic diseases that necessitate long-term intravenous therapy drives up demand for home-based IV equipment. Patients suffering from ailments such as cancer, autoimmune disorders, or genetic diseases benefit from ongoing therapies administered at home, leading to an increase in the use of IV equipment designed for this purpose. The ageing population in Italy adds to the expansion of home care settings. The simplicity and personalised care of home-based treatments appeal to elderly people who require continuing IV therapy for disorders such as diabetes, hypertension, or nutritional support. Government policies promoting homecare and decentralisation of healthcare services contribute to the segment's rapid growth. Subsidies, payment schemes, and policies that promote home-based therapies increase the use of IV equipment in home care settings.
